Overview

The current clinical management system used by the service operates as a standalone platform and is not integrated with other genetics, hospital, or NHS Wales systems. This lack of interoperability presents challenges in accessing and managing patient information efficiently. Genetic family files are currently stored across multiple sites and locations, which increases the time and effort required to retrieve records, introduces potential risks, and can delay clinical decision-making.To address these issues, the service is seeking to implement a more centralised and integrated solution that will streamline access to patient data, improve information governance, and enhance clinical workflows. Centralising records will help ensure that clinicians have timely and secure access to the information they need, reducing administrative burden and improving patient care outcomes.Furthermore, the ability to generate accurate and detailed reports is essential for effective service planning, resource allocation, and workload management. A modernised system will support these operational needs by enabling better data capture, analysis, and reporting capabilities.This procurement reflects the service’s commitment to improving digital infrastructure in line with broader NHS Wales objectives, ensuring that systems are fit for purpose and capable of supporting future service developments.
